Summary of the comparison

Bengeo Primary School and Hertford St Andrew CofE Primary School are primary schools in Hertford.

  • Bengeo Primary School scores 72 out of 100 (grade B, strong) and Hertford St Andrew CofE Primary School scores 59 out of 100 (grade C, average). Bengeo Primary School is ahead on our composite score.

  • Bengeo Primary School was judged Outstanding and Hertford St Andrew CofE Primary School was judged Good.

  • The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has fallen at Bengeo Primary School (75.0% in 2022-23, 61.0% in 2024-25).
